Judo Legend teddy riner Launches Inaugural riner Cup for Amateur Athletes

Asnières-sur-Seine, France – Eight-time Olympic medalist Teddy Riner is set to host the first-ever Riner Cup, a judo competition designed for amateur athletes, scheduled for April 5-6, 2025. The event at the Teddy Riner Arena aims to provide a platform for non-professional judokas to showcase their skills, with over 500 participants already registered.

Riner Cup: A New Stage for Aspiring Judokas

Teddy Riner,recovering from an elbow surgery,introduced the Riner cup as a way to give back to the sport and support amateur competitors.Open to judokas from cadet to senior levels with at least a green belt, the competition offers a unique possibility for athletes who frequently enough receive less visibility than their professional counterparts.Cash prizes will be awarded to adult winners, with additional prizes for younger competitors.
